Wagtail Orderable

Simple orderable mixin to add drag-and-drop ordering support to the ModelAdmin listing view.

It attempts to provide the feature request in Wagtail project without modifying the project code as it seems not a high priority item for the project.

Installation

Install the package

pip install wagtail-orderable

Settings

In your settings file, add wagtailorderable to INSTALLED_APPS:

INSTALLED_APPS = [
    # ...
    'wagtailorderable',
    # ...
]

Usage

Extends with Orderable (optionnal)

To apply the orderable feature, you can extend your model with Orderable which will add a sort_order IntegerField to your model but if you already have a field to store an index value, this is not required.

from django.db import models

from wagtailorderable.models import Orderable


class YourModel(models.Model, Orderable):
    title = models.CharField(max_length=200)

Of course you can apply it to Wagtail's Page model.

from wagtail.core import fields
from wagtail.core.models import Page

from wagtailorderable.models import Orderable


class YourModel(Page, Orderable):
    description = fields.RichTextField(blank=True)

Or just use your model with your personnal ordering field.

from django.db import models


class YourOtherModel(models.Model):
    title = models.CharField(max_length=200)
    my_custom_order_field = models.IntegerField(null=False, blank=True, default=0, editable=False)

Note that Orderable also exists in wagtail.core.models, DO NOT use that as the mixins require the model from the same package.

To apply the feature support in admin panel. In wagtail_hooks.py:

from wagtail.contrib.modeladmin.options import (
    ModelAdmin, modeladmin_register)

from wagtailorderable.modeladmin.mixins import OrderableMixin

from .models import YourModel, YourOtherModel


class YourModelAdmin(OrderableMixin, ModelAdmin):
    model = YourModel


class YourOtherModelAdmin(OrderableMixin, ModelAdmin):
    model = YourOtherModel
    index_order_field = 'my_custom_order_field'

modeladmin_register(YourModelAdmin)
modeladmin_register(YourOtherModelAdmin)

Note that index_order_field is optionnal if you extends your model with Orderable or if your Model has a index_order_field attribute.

Finally, collect the corresponding static file by running

python manage.py collectstatic

in your project.

Change Log

1.0.4

  • Extending Orderable is no more mandatory if you want to use your own order field (#27)
  • Add Orderable.get_sort_order_max() to get the max "order" when instance is being created (#27)
  • Fix keeping current filters when sorting was reset (#27)
  • Fix class names (get_extra_class_names_for_field_col parameters were inverted) (#27)
  • Fix CSS which had SCSS syntax (#27)

1.0.3

  • Fix TypeError when creating the first Orderable object (#21)

1.0.2

  • Fix sort_order duplication for items
  • Fix wrong return syntax

1.0.1

  • get_list_display handles any iterable
  • Support for filters in ModelAdmin
  • Style updated
